i haven't posted in a while because of my busy schedule...i have been burning the candle at both ends the past couple of months and looking forward to my semi-annual guys golf trip this weekend.

i thought i would go out and hit a couple of buckets of ***** today and took out my porsche design 11.5 degree driver...it has been a great club over the past year of ownership.

today after hitting only a few ***** i heard a weird sound and there was something inside the club head rattling around...when i took a close look at the club i noticed the face of the club basically collapsed....i've never seen anything like this before and when i searched for a new porsche design driver today, i was told by a well know fellow in san diego who built these clubs that they had a design flaw with some of the club heads because of the poor materials supplied to the club builders.

if you look at the top of the club you can see where the face is pushed into the club and there is a significant "bulge" on the top with chipped paint instead of a smooth rounded finish.
